Loading...
The Port of Last Resort: Zuflucht in Shanghai (1998) documents the poignant stories of Jewish refugees who fled to Shanghai during World War II to escape Nazi persecution. This historical documentary highlights their resilience and the complex relationships they formed in their new, unlikely sanctuary.
Screen Full Screen 1.33:1
Subtitles English, French, German, Japanese, Spanish
Audio English: Dolby Digital 2.0 Stereo
German: Dolby Digital 2.0 Stereo
Rating NR
Average of ratings:
stars